Elden Ring Nightreign: A Gameplay-Focused Return of Classic FromSoftware Bosses

Elden Ring Nightreign Brings Dark Souls Bosses Back, Just Don't Think Too Hard About the Lore Implications

Nightreign, the latest Elden Ring expansion, features a roster of bosses drawn from both the Elden Ring universe and previous FromSoftware titles. Director Junya Ishizaki clarified the reasoning behind this in a recent Gamespot interview (February 12, 2025), emphasizing a gameplay-driven approach rather than a complex lore integration.

Ishizaki stated that the diverse boss selection was crucial for Nightreign's gameplay experience. The team leveraged familiar bosses from past games to enhance the challenge and variety, acknowledging the player's fondness for these iconic encounters. The focus remains on the enjoyment of the combat, rather than forcing a strict narrative connection. While acknowledging the rich lore surrounding these characters, Ishizaki confirmed that the inclusion wasn't intended to significantly impact the established lore of the Elden Ring universe. The primary antagonist, the Night Lord, and its connection to Elden Ring's overarching narrative, are expected to be the main focus of the lore.

"We didn't want to encroach too much on that lore aspect," Ishizaki explained. "We wanted them to make sense within the atmosphere and vibe of Elden Ring Nightreign." He further added that including these bosses was simply "kind of fun."

Familiar Faces in Nightreign:

Confirmed appearances include the Nameless King from Dark Souls 3 (DS3), known for his challenging lightning and wind attacks, and the Centipede Demon from the original Dark Souls, a multi-headed monstrosity that spews fire. The Duke's Dear Freja, a massive spider from Dark Souls 2, is also heavily speculated to appear based on imagery in the trailer.

While integrating these bosses' existing lore into Elden Ring's narrative would be complex, Ishizaki's comments suggest players should prioritize the gameplay experience rather than overanalyzing the lore implications. The focus should be on the challenge and enjoyment of battling these classic foes within the unique setting of Nightreign.
